HC Deb 27 October 1955 vol 545 c51W
93. Mr. Teeling

asked the Secretary of State for the Home Department whether he is aware that his Department informed owners of ships on the no-passport day excursions lines that a meeting with them would take place soon after the end of September; when such meeting is being held; and whether he will make a statement about the future extension of these trips to start from Brighton.

Major Lloyd-George

Yes. I am arranging for a meeting to be held next week and the question of introducing no-passport excursions from Brighton will be one of the matters for discussion.
